If you have a captain in any researchable, free ship and move him to any other researchable, free ship of that same nation you have to retrain him. He'll lose his training for the ship he came out of.

 

If you have a captain in any researchable, free ship and move him to a premium ship of that same nation you don't need to retrain him, and you can move him back again without penalty.
